More investments are anticipated for Irapuato

By Lizete Hernandez

Guanajuato

February 15, 2019





The municipality of Irapuato reported about 2,500 million pesos as part of 30 investment projects of national and foreign capital, same that were reflected on different sectors such as the automotive, real estate and of services, thus was announced by Luis Hernandez, general director of Economic Development of Irapuato.

 He noted that the arrival of new companies will generate about 5,000 direct jobs, as he anticipated that there are observed at least seven projects of foreign investment.

“We have the report that the adequacy of spaces for companies continues on several industrial parks for companies about to start the construction of their plants, many of them will be the first ones in Latin America, that is why we are assured that the investment and projects will continue during the upcoming years,” he said.

 He noted that most of these investments come from national capital, but also from Japanese and European, same that will be settled during this year and that sum more than 2,500 million pesos.

 However, he noted that with these investments are also investment projects on hotels, restaurants and at least two shopping centers of great dimension, as foreign population has increased on this municipality, as well as the number of inhabitants, since the arrival of people from different municipalities of the state of Guanajuato and States from the northern area of the country is registered. 

 Likewise, he determined that the growth towards the northern part of the city has rebounded with the arrival of companies but also of the creation of residential complexes to face the housing demand in the city. 

REBOUND ON TRADITIONAL SECTORS

 Even though, Luis Hernandez said that one of the main activities in Irapuato, is commerce, this has unchained that many companies dedicated to market a product see the opportunity of joining the services suppliers’ chain for any institution, Government office, but also for national and international companies.

 He emphasized that he knows that about 2,500 Japanese live in the entity, from which 50 % are settled in Irapuato, therefore it is very important to bet on improving the services addressed to this foreign community specifically.

He noted that the growing dynamic in the services sector will continue, mainly in the northern area that will have a rebound with the opening of the Fourth Vial Belt, and the improvement of roads.

Likewise, he explained that other areas that have been attractive for industrial parks’ developers are the southern area and the exit Abasolo, since it represents an exponential growth together with the attraction of industrial investment.
